I used to eagerly await recruiting news. Today? Not so much, and not because of recent events.

With the college game now a professional enterprise recruiting success is nice, but it is not going to be determinative of success.

Need a player at a position? Get your wallet out and pick from the dozens available for transfer.

Hire a new coach? Let him bring along his players he can trust to perform.

It’s a question of two things - 1. Commitment and 2. Money . Doubt that? Look at Indiana and Texas Tech.

This impacts coaching hires. It makes sense to hire coaches who have professional experience. Juggling budgets and rosters is going to grow in importance. Head coaches are no longer omnipotent rulers, they are 50 percent coach and 50 percent general manager.

Can a new coach bring his recruiting class with him based on NCAA rules?
If they didn’t sign with his previous school, then they can sign with the new coach in February. If they already signed with the previous school they have to enter the portal.
